Day 2: Sunrise Big Five Game Drive & Lake Ihema Boat Safari
After breakfast, start the day with a private sunrise game drive.
This game drive will take you through vast Savannah plains, woodlands and lake shores to look for the big five (Elephants, Buffaloes, Lions, Leopards and Rhinos) and other animals.
For bird enthusiasts, you can sight different birds like African grey hornbill, Red faced barbet, Giant kingfisher among others. Expect to spend about 2 – 3 hours on the game.
After this encounter, return to the lodge for lunch and relaxation.
Later in the afternoon, embark on a boat cruise along Lake Ihema. Lake Ihema is the second largest lake in Rwanda.
You will sight hippos, crocodiles and countless water birds. Return to the park to enjoy sundowners overlooking the water and a gourmet dinner at the camp. Dinner and Overnight Stay.
Best Time to do Game drive and Boat cruise
It’s during the dry seasons from June to September and December to February. During these months, the weather is pleasant, wildlife sightings are abundant.

Day 7: Exclusive Chimpanzee Tracking in Ancient Rainforests
After an early breakfast, head out for an exclusive chimpanzee trekking experience in Nyungwe Forest, one of the best places in Africa to track these remarkable primates in the wild.
You will meet up with your driver guide who will transfer you at the briefing center at 5: 30 am. After briefing, a private guide will take you into the forest to track the chimpanzees.
Depending on the location of the chimpanzees, trekking can last anywhere from 1 to 4 hours to locate the chimpanzees.
Once you find the chimps, you will have 1 hour to observe them from a safe distance. During this time, you will learn about their behavior, social structure, and the forest ecosystem.
It’s a unique opportunity to witness the chimps in their natural environment, often displaying social behaviors, feeding, playing, or grooming.
After the trek, return to our lodge for a well-deserved lunch, followed by some relaxation. You will have time to reflect on your experience and share stories from the trek.
Best time to do Exclusive Chimpanzee Trekking.
Dry Seasons (June to September & December to February). The trails are less muddy and slippery, making trekking easier and more comfortable. The lack of rain also makes it easier to track the chimps.
Shoulder Seasons (March to May & October to November)
These months fall in the rainy season, so the park is quieter, and there are fewer tourists. If you prefer more solitude, this might be a great time to visit.
The trails can be much more challenging, with more rain and mud, which makes trekking harder and potentially less enjoyable. But it also offers a more authentic jungle experience.

Day 8: Colobus Monkey Trekking & High-Altitude Canopy Walk
After breakfast, you will head out for exclusive colobus monkey trekking.
Your driver guide will drive you to the Nyungwe National Park briefing center which is located at the Uwinka Visitor Center.
Following the briefing, you will be assigned a private guide which ensures a more personalized and intimate experience.
The trek usually lasts about 1 to 2 hours depending on the location of the monkeys.
The colobus monkeys are typically found in high-altitude bamboo forests and are very active, so expect to see them leap through the trees and socialize.
The terrain can be steep in some areas, so wear comfortable trekking shoes and be ready for a moderate hike.
Your private guide will not only help you track the monkeys but also share valuable insights about their behavior, diet, and the unique ecology of Nyungwe forests.
The monkeys are incredibly playful and often move around in large groups, offering great opportunities for photographs and close observation.
After spending quality time with the monkeys, return to the lodge where you can relax and enjoy a refreshing lunch.
Later in the afternoon, you will head back to the Uwinka Visitor Center for the Canopy Walk experience.
Before you set foot on the canopy, you will receive a briefing from a park ranger about safety precautions and the best way to enjoy the walk.
The walk is a series of suspension bridges that allow you to feel the forest’s pulse as you move from tree to tree.
From this vantage point, you can spot wildlife that lives in the upper layers of the forest, such as monkeys, birds, and butterflies.
The canopy walks last approximately 1 -2 hours, giving you plenty of time to enjoy the sights and sounds of Nyungwe’s treetop world. Return to the lodge where you will have time to relax and reflect on your adventure in the rainforest. Dinner and Overnight stay.

Day 10: First Mountain Gorilla Trekking Encounter in Bwindi
Early start for your first Gorilla trek in Volcanoes National Park headquarters in Kinigi.
The park is just a short drive from the lodge but it’s important to arrive early to complete the necessary formalities.
After the briefing, you will be transferred by vehicle to the starting point for your trek. The trek begins as you follow an experienced guide and porters through the dense rainforest.
The gorilla families are tracked by rangers and guides who know the general location of the gorillas, but you may still need to hike through thick vegetation.
Some trekking routes are easy, while others may be more challenging. As you get closer to the gorillas, you’ll be asked to stay quiet and follow the guide’s instructions.
You’ll have approximately 1 hour to observe the gorillas once you’ve found them.
You will have a chance to take photos but remember to keep the experience as natural as possible. Get your certificate and transfer back to your lodge for lunch. Dinner and Overnight stay.
